1. Oats are typically eaten by humans as oatmeal or rolled oats, while wheat is a raw product that is used to make flours for baking cakes and pastries.
2. Wheat can also be used in construction, harnessing fuels, and for making beer or other similar alcoholic beverages.
3. An oat diet tends to lower LDL levels when compared to a wheat diet. In turn, this makes oats the best cereal to counter heart diseases.
